The Indonesia emission management software market is witnessing significant growth due to the increasing awareness about environmental sustainability and stringent government regulations aimed at reducing carbon emissions. The market is characterized by the adoption of advanced technologies such as artificial intelligence and machine learning to monitor and manage emissions effectively. Key players in the market are focusing on developing innovative solutions to help industries track, analyze, and report their emissions data accurately. The growing emphasis on corporate social responsibility and the shift towards sustainable business practices are driving the demand for emission management software in various sectors including manufacturing, energy, and transportation. Overall, the Indonesia emission management software market is projected to continue expanding as organizations strive to minimize their environmental footprint and comply with regulatory requirements.

In the Indonesia emission management software market, key challenges include the lack of awareness and understanding among businesses regarding the importance of monitoring and managing emissions, limited government regulations and enforcement, and the high upfront costs associated with implementing emission management software. Additionally, the diverse industrial landscape in Indonesia presents a challenge in developing software solutions that cater to the specific needs of various sectors. Integration with existing systems and ensuring data accuracy and reliability are also hurdles faced by companies looking to adopt emission management software. To overcome these challenges, software providers need to focus on educating the market, developing cost-effective solutions, and collaborating with industry stakeholders to tailor software offerings to meet the unique requirements of Indonesian businesses.

In Indonesia, the government has implemented various policies related to emission management software to address environmental concerns. The Ministry of Environment and Forestry has set regulations requiring industries to monitor and report their emissions using specialized software. Additionally, the government has introduced incentives and subsidies to encourage the adoption of emission management software among businesses to reduce their carbon footprint. Furthermore, there are initiatives to promote research and development in this sector to enhance the effectiveness of emission management solutions. Overall, the government`s focus on enhancing environmental sustainability through the regulation and promotion of emission management software is driving growth and innovation in the Indonesian market.
